In anticipation of this month's £1million Ground Shaker 2 bingo showdown, the UK's National Bingo Game Association has hired a life coach to help players get ready for the event. While it's common knowledge that bingo is a game of luck, life coach Paul Bellard claims that luck is completely under our control.
Bellard has devised an approach to help players change their state of mind, and thus, he believes, their luck. According to Bellard, “The key factor in changing your luck is that it all starts within you. The way in which you perceive the world through your eyes will dramatically improve your life and how lucky you feel if you are positive and self-assured." Bellard's plan is a 10-step method relating to a person's approach to bingo, as well as life in general.
These perspectives include gems such as, "Use incantations: Take the time to talk positively to yourself – we all have voices in our heads so put it to good use as you travel to the bingo club. For instance, I AM a lucky person, I EXPERIENCE good luck everyday, I am SO lucky." and " Visualise success: See yourself winning, imagine people congratulating you, then remember how that feels and exaggerate that feeling. Stand up and clench your fist as you access how that makes you feel and remember that feeling!"
